WeWork's US president — and Adam Neumann's friend — will leave days after the firm's new CEO joins

Mathrani named a new chief operating officer on Thursday, and more executive shakeups are likely on the way. Arik Benzino joined WeWork in August 2017, per his LinkedIn profile. A friend of 's from Israel, Benzino was one of the few executives who stayed long after the controversial founder's September ouster. It's not immediately clear if anyone will replace him.
"We are grateful to Arik for his contributions to the company. He has graciously agreed to help with the transition, and we wish him well in his future endeavors," a WeWork representative said in a statement. New York-based Benzino was also on the board of Laird Superfoods. In January 2019, WeWork led a $32 million funding round for the health foods company, which was founded by a professional surfer. The company did not immediately respond to a request for comment about its board.
